7. Redis

It is a popular open-source database project. According to Stack Overflow’s Annual Developer Survey, Redis is ranked as the Most Loved Database platform. As a distributed, in-memory key-value database, it can be used. Redis can also be used as a distributed cache and message broker, with durability as an option.

8. Elasticsearch

Elasticsearch is an open core full-text search engine based on Lucene that was first released in 2010 by Shay Banon. It’s a full-text search engine with a distributed, multi-tenant capability and a REST API.

It provides horizontal scaling via automatic sharing and REST API. It also supports structured and schema less data (JSON), which is especially suited to analyze Logging or Monitoring data.

9. Cassandra

It is an open core, distributed, wide column store and commonly used database for an application that was developed in 2008. This is a highly scalable database management software that is widely used by the industries to handle massive data.

One of its main features is its decentralized database (Leaderless) having automatic replication and multi-data center replication, leading it to become a fault-tolerant base without any failures. Cassandra has several different operations and infrastructure. Cassandra and HBase databases go a long way and have different use cases according to their types.

10. MariaDB

It is a Relational Database Management System which is compatible with MySQL Protocol and Clients. The MySQL server can be easily replaced with MariaDB without requiring any code changes.

This management system provides columnar storage with massively parallel distributed data architecture. In comparison to MySQL, MariaDB is more community-driven.

12. SQLite

SQLite is an open-source best SQL database with an integrated relational database management system. It was created in the year 2000. It’s a top database that requires no configuration and doesn’t even require a server or installation. Despite its simplicity, it contains many commonly used database management system software functionalities to be used in mobile web development like react native.

13. DynamoDB

DynamoDB is a nonrelational best database from Amazon. It is a serverless database for mobile apps that scales up and down automatically while also backing up your data.

This database program features built-in security and in-memory caching, as well as consistent latency.

14. Neo4j

Neo4j is an open-source, Java-based NoSQL graph database that was launched in 2007. It uses a query language known as Cypher, labeled on its site as the most efficient and expressive way to describe relationship queries.

In this database management system software, your data is saved as graphs rather than tables. Neo4j’s relationship system is quick that allows you to create and use other relationships later to “shortcut” and speed up domain data as the need arises.

Which Database Is Best For Python?

The Python programming language has amazing database programming features. Python upholds different list of databases like SQLite, Oracle, MySQL, PostgreSQL, and so forth. Python likewise supports Data Definition Language (DDL), Data Manipulation Language (DML), and Data Query Statements. Python DB-API is the Python standard for database interfaces. Most Python database interfaces stick to this norm.

Here we will talk about one of the best databases for web applications: SQLite

SQLite

SQLite is likely the most clear database and the most popular SQL databases to connect with a Python application since you don’t have to install any external Python SQL database or type or SQL database modules. As a matter of course, your Python installation contains a Python SQL library named SQLite3 that you can utilize to connect and interact with an SQLite database.

What is the most widely used database model today? ›

The relational database model is the most used database model today. However, other database models exist with different strengths. The hierarchical database model, popular in the 1960s and 1970s, connected data together in a hierarchy, allowing for a parent/child relationship between data.
